The student population at Alabama School of Nail Technology & Cosmetology is 97 (all undergraduate). The number of students has increased by 80 over the past decade.
All students have enrolled in on-campus classes (Alabama School of Nail Technology & Cosmetology does not offer online degree/certificate program).

Enrollment by Race/Ethnicity Changes
The percentage of white students is 46.39% and the percentage of black students is 45.36% at Alabama School of Nail Technology & Cosmetology. 2.06% of enrolled students is Asian. Hispanic students comprise 2.06% of the student body.
Over the past 10 years, the racial composition has shifted. The percentage of white students decreased from 58.82% to 46.39%. Asian enrollment grew from 0.00% to 2.06%. Black student enrollment increased from 35.29% to 45.36%. Hispanic student representation contracted from 5.88% to 2.06%.
The overall racial diversity, measured by the Census Bureau Diversity Index, is 0.5773 which indicates that moderately diverse. This increased from 0.5260 a decade ago, suggesting that racial diversity has improved.
